Lengthening days in Shanghai through May 1969
Across May 1969, daylight in Shanghai, China stretches out — the month opens with 13h 22m of daylight and closes with 14h 01m (a swing of about 39 minutes). Expect a change of around 9 minutes from one week to the next.
The earliest sunrise falls at 04:51 on May 29 and the latest at 05:10 on May 1, while sunset ranges from 18:32 on May 1 to 18:52 on May 31.
